About
The Attitude Control Module PnP ADCS-N1 is a fully integrated, plug-and-play attitude determination and control system (ADCS) for small satellites, combining a complete suite of sensors and actuators in a single module. It includes 2 star trackers (5 arcsec pointing / 50 arcsec rolling accuracy at 3-sigma, 10 Hz update rate, 2 deg/s dynamic range), a sun sensor (0.1 deg accuracy, 10 Hz, 90×90 deg FOV), a gyroscope (0.5 deg/h zero-bias stability, 0.03 deg/sqrt(h) angle random walk, +/-300 deg/s rate range), a magnetometer (+/-8 Gauss range, +/-1.0% FS linearity error, 10 nT field error), 4 reaction flywheels (20 mNms max angular momentum, 2.5 mNm max torque, 1 rpm speed control accuracy), 3 magnetic torquers (0.82 A*m2 at 12V / 0.34 A*m2 at 5V max magnetic moment), and a GNSS receiver (<=10 m position resolution, <=0.1 m/s velocity accuracy). By packaging attitude sensing, control actuation, and navigation into a single plug-and-play module, the ADCS-N1 simplifies satellite bus integration and provides full 3-axis attitude determination and control capability for small satellite/CubeSat missions.
